索引
All Classes and Interfaces|所有程序包|序列化表格
A
- afterPropertiesSet() - 类中的方法 org.anyline.data.jdbc.neo4j.Neo4jAdapter
B
- buildDeleteRunFromEntity(DataRuntime, Table, Object, String...) - 类中的方法 org.anyline.data.jdbc.neo4j.Neo4jAdapter
- buildDeleteRunFromTable(DataRuntime, int, String, ConfigStore, String, Object) - 类中的方法 org.anyline.data.jdbc.neo4j.Neo4jAdapter
- buildInsertRun(DataRuntime, int, Table, Object, List<String>) - 类中的方法 org.anyline.data.jdbc.neo4j.Neo4jAdapter
-
创建 insert 最终可执行命令
- buildUpdateRunFromCollection(DataRuntime, int, String, Collection, ConfigStore, LinkedHashMap<String, Column>) - 类中的方法 org.anyline.data.jdbc.neo4j.Neo4jAdapter
- buildUpdateRunFromDataRow(DataRuntime, Table, DataRow, ConfigStore, LinkedHashMap<String, Column>) - 类中的方法 org.anyline.data.jdbc.neo4j.Neo4jAdapter
- buildUpdateRunFromEntity(DataRuntime, Table, Object, ConfigStore, LinkedHashMap<String, Column>) - 类中的方法 org.anyline.data.jdbc.neo4j.Neo4jAdapter
C
- createConditionFindInSet(DataRuntime, StringBuilder, String, Compare, Object, boolean) - 类中的方法 org.anyline.data.jdbc.neo4j.Neo4jAdapter
- createConditionIn(DataRuntime, StringBuilder, Compare, Object, boolean) - 类中的方法 org.anyline.data.jdbc.neo4j.Neo4jAdapter
-
构造(NOT) IN 查询条件
- createConditionLike(DataRuntime, StringBuilder, Compare, Object, boolean) - 类中的方法 org.anyline.data.jdbc.neo4j.Neo4jAdapter
-
构造 LIKE 查询条件 MATCH (n:Dept) where n.name CONTAINS '财务' RETURN n MATCH (n:Dept) where n.name STARTS WITH '财' RETURN n MATCH (n:Dept) where n.name ENDS WITH '财' RETURN n
- createInsertRun(DataRuntime, Table, Object, ConfigStore, List<String>) - 类中的方法 org.anyline.data.jdbc.neo4j.Neo4jAdapter
-
根据entity创建 INSERT RunPrepare
- createInsertRunFromCollection(DataRuntime, int, Table, Collection, ConfigStore, List<String>) - 类中的方法 org.anyline.data.jdbc.neo4j.Neo4jAdapter
-
根据collection创建 INSERT RunPrepare
F
- fillDeleteRunContent(DataRuntime, TableRun) - 类中的方法 org.anyline.data.jdbc.neo4j.Neo4jAdapter
- fillInsertContent(DataRuntime, Run, Table, Collection, ConfigStore, LinkedHashMap<String, Column>) - 类中的方法 org.anyline.data.jdbc.neo4j.Neo4jAdapter
-
根据Collection创建批量INSERT create(:Dept{name:1}), (:Dept{name:2}), (:Dept{name:3})
- fillInsertContent(DataRuntime, Run, Table, DataSet, ConfigStore, LinkedHashMap<String, Column>) - 类中的方法 org.anyline.data.jdbc.neo4j.Neo4jAdapter
-
根据DataSet创建批量INSERT RunPrepare CREATE (:Dept{name:1}), (:Dept{name:2}), (:Dept{name:3})
- fillQueryContent(DataRuntime, TableRun) - 类中的方法 org.anyline.data.jdbc.neo4j.Neo4jAdapter
-
生成基础查询主体
- fillQueryContent(DataRuntime, TextRun) - 类中的方法 org.anyline.data.jdbc.neo4j.Neo4jAdapter
-
生成基础查询主体
- fillQueryContent(DataRuntime, XMLRun) - 类中的方法 org.anyline.data.jdbc.neo4j.Neo4jAdapter
-
生成基础查询主体
I
- identity(DataRuntime, String, Object, ConfigStore, KeyHolder) - 类中的方法 org.anyline.data.jdbc.neo4j.Neo4jAdapter
-
insert执行后 通过KeyHolder获取主键值赋值给data
- insert(DataRuntime, String, Object, ConfigStore, Run, String[]) - 类中的方法 org.anyline.data.jdbc.neo4j.Neo4jAdapter
-
执行 insert
- insertValue(String, Run, Table, Object, LinkedHashMap<String, Column>) - 类中的方法 org.anyline.data.jdbc.neo4j.Neo4jAdapter
-
生成insert sql的value部分, 每个Entity(每行数据)调用一次 (:User{name:'ZH', age:20})
M
- mergeFinalExists(DataRuntime, Run) - 类中的方法 org.anyline.data.jdbc.neo4j.Neo4jAdapter
- mergeFinalQuery(DataRuntime, Run) - 类中的方法 org.anyline.data.jdbc.neo4j.Neo4jAdapter
-
MATCH (n) WHERE n.name='u1' RETURN n ORDER BY n.age DESC SKIP 0 LIMIT 200
- mergeFinalTotal(DataRuntime, Run) - 类中的方法 org.anyline.data.jdbc.neo4j.Neo4jAdapter
-
求总数SQL Run 反转调用
N
- Neo4jAdapter - org.anyline.data.jdbc.neo4j中的类
- Neo4jAdapter() - 类的构造器 org.anyline.data.jdbc.neo4j.Neo4jAdapter
- Neo4jDataRow - org.anyline.data.jdbc.neo4j.entity中的类
- Neo4jDataRow() - 类的构造器 org.anyline.data.jdbc.neo4j.entity.Neo4jDataRow
- Neo4jRow - org.anyline.data.jdbc.neo4j.entity中的类
- Neo4jRow() - 类的构造器 org.anyline.data.jdbc.neo4j.entity.Neo4jRow
O
- org.anyline.data.jdbc.neo4j - 程序包 org.anyline.data.jdbc.neo4j
- org.anyline.data.jdbc.neo4j.entity - 程序包 org.anyline.data.jdbc.neo4j.entity
P
- process(DataRuntime, List<Map<String, Object>>) - 类中的方法 org.anyline.data.jdbc.neo4j.Neo4jAdapter
-
JDBC执行结果处理 return e 只有一个return项时执行 [e:{id:1, name:''}, e:{id:2, name:''}] 转换成 [, {id:1, name:''}, {id:2, name:''}]
T
- type() - 类中的方法 org.anyline.data.jdbc.neo4j.Neo4jAdapter
All Classes and Interfaces|所有程序包|序列化表格